I am in need of a controller and probe for my Vulcan tilt skillet, However I am not able to find the model number on the equipment to ensure I order the right part. Any help would be greatly appreciated.
I don’t know where Vulcan puts the data plate on those. You might need to employ a screwdriver to access behind panels. Sometimes a data plate is just GONE, so you’re forced to match it to pictures from the manufacture’s literature. I’ve had to do that…too many times.

Check wherever the gas valve is located, or where the trunnion is for the tilt mechanism. Has to be one of those or near them. Normally in a place you don’t touch so the sticker stays fresh forever more.
If you have the original “Installation & Operation Manual” filed away somewhere, it will tell you which model as well the specific location of the data plate for the model to obtain the serial number for warranty registration. Most of the Vulcan units place it inside the right side panel facing the front.
